Availability of Vertical Class I Hitch for 2002 Honda Accord Sedan  

Question:

I have an 02 Honda Accord Sedan. Is there any possibility of a vertical hitch, like that shown for the Scion xB? If not, can I mount the hidden hitch so I can attach/remove it quickly from the outside? Do I have to drill holes in the floor pan? I would like to tow a bike rack, or possibly a 200 lb boat. Expert Reply:

For your 2002 Honda Accord Sedan there is no vertical hitch offered. The unit you referenced, model 28501 for the Scion xB, is not adaptable to your Accord.

We offer only one hitch for your Accord. It is the curt # C11290 and is a light-duty Class I hitch. The is a cost-effective option for you. This hitch installs without drilling and the installation instructions are linked for your reference. The required mounting hardware is included.

Installation of any hitch must be done exactly as per the manufacturer instructions. A hitch's rated capacity is based on the specific installation process as tested by the hitch manufacturer. Hitches are not designed for routine removal; each time a hitch is installed (or re-installed) new hardware must be used to ensure safe operation.

I was not able to verify a rated towing capacity for your 2002 Accord Sedan; your owner's manual or local dealership should be able verify if the car is rated by Honda for towing.

Please note that a Class I hitch can handle the weight of up to 2 bikes, but not more than two. The linked article will explain hitch classes in further detail.
